How Ice-Cooling Fans Work: Evaporative Cooling Meets Powerful Airflow
Ice-cooling fans use simple physics and smart engineering. They draw warm air over water or ice, cooling it down. Then, they blow that cooler air right to you.

Evaporative cooling: air passes over water or ice to shed heat
When air hits a moist pad or ice, water evaporates and takes heat away. This makes the air cooler and drier. It also makes you feel cooler, all while using less energy.
Ice chamber fan design: boosting cooling performance with colder reservoirs
Using water, ice, or both in a reservoir makes cooling better. Air gets colder faster as it passes over the ice. This keeps the cooling steady and effective.

Science and Safety: When Fans Excel—and Their Limits in Extreme Heat
Fans are great in many places, but their power changes with the weather. Knowing when they work best helps us use them wisely. This is true for fans in homes, offices, and during hot summer days.
Evidence from human heat-balance modeling: modest impact in very high heat
Researchers at the University of Ottawa studied how fans affect our body heat. They looked at 116,640 scenarios. Fans help sweat evaporate, but they don't cool us down as much as air conditioning does in very hot weather.

Supporting air conditioning to reduce set points and save energy
Using fans with air conditioning can make your home cooler without using more energy. Fans help spread the cooled air, making you feel cooler for less energy. This combo can save you money and keep your home comfortable.
Considerations for older adults and vulnerable groups
Older people, those with chronic illnesses, and workers who exert themselves may not sweat as much. In extreme heat, fans might not be enough for them. Make sure they have access to cool spaces and stay hydrated.
